With the Government conducting a competitive exam for recruitment to Group-C Non-technical posts on Dec. 4, 5 and 19 in various centres of the city, the Police have clamped prohibitory orders in 200 mts radius of all the exam centres on these dates, in order to ensure smooth conduct of the exam. The ban orders will be in force from 6 am to 6 pm on the said three days (Dec. 4, 5 and 19) and photocopy shops in the vicinity of all the centres have been asked to shut down for the day. Today, the exam was held at two centres — Maharani’s Arts College for Women and Government Bifurcated Maharaja PU College, Nazarbad. Tomorrow (Dec. 5), the exam will take place at 20 centres spread across the city. On Dec. 19, the competitive exam will be held at 23 centres, according to a press release.
